如何传值给PHP
单元1:使用表单传递值给PHP
步骤1:创建一个HTML表单,包含输入字段和提交按钮。
步骤2:在表单中设置输入字段的名称属性,以便在PHP中获取对应的值。
步骤3:将表单的action属性设置为处理表单数据的PHP文件的URL。
步骤4:设置表单的method属性为POST,以确保数据以安全的方式传输。
单元2:使用超链接传递值给PHP
步骤1:创建一个包含要传递的值的超链接。
步骤2:将超链接的目标属性设置为处理数据的PHP文件的URL,并在URL中添加要传递的值作为查询参数。
步骤3:用户点击超链接时,浏览器将请求指定的PHP文件,并将查询参数传递给它。
单元3:使用GET方法传递值给PHP
步骤1:在PHP文件中,使用$_GET全局变量来获取通过GET方法传递的值。
步骤2:通过检查特定的键是否存在于$_GET数组中,可以获取相应的值。
步骤3:可以使用isset()函数来检查键是否存在,以避免未定义的错误。
单元4:使用POST方法传递值给PHP
步骤1:在PHP文件中,使用$_POST全局变量来获取通过POST方法传递的值。
步骤2:通过检查特定的键是否存在于$_POST数组中,可以获取相应的值。
步骤3:可以使用isset()函数来检查键是否存在,以避免未定义的错误。
相关问题与解答:
问题1:如何在PHP中使用GET方法传递多个值?
解答1:可以在URL中使用&符号连接多个查询参数,每个参数之间用=符号分隔,example.php?param1=value1¶m2=value2,在PHP中,可以使用$_GET[‘param1’]和$_GET[‘param2’]来获取这些值。
问题2:如何在PHP中使用POST方法传递数组或对象?
解答2:在HTML表单中,可以使用<input type="text" name="array[]">来传递数组,]表示数组元素,在PHP中,可以使用$_POST[‘array’]来获取整个数组,对于对象,可以使用json_decode()函数将JSON字符串转换为PHP对象,在HTML表单中,可以使用<textarea>元素来传递JSON字符串,并设置contentType为application/json,在PHP中,可以使用json_decode()函数将JSON字符串转换为PHP对象。
原创文章,作者:未希,如若转载,请注明出处:https://www.kdun.com/ask/564542.html
本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。
发表回复